Did you have a bike when you were a child?
スコア: 48.0提案: 纠正事实与语法错误,回答要直接并且连贯。首先开门见山回答问题(过去时),然后补充一到两句具体细节。注意时态一致(过去式),主谓一致,以及词汇使用(bag→bike? blanket 可能要解释为坐垫或遮盖物)。例如可以说明自行车的样子、颜色、谁给你的或你如何使用它。保持句子不超过五句并使用连接词使表达自然。
例: Yes, I did. I had a large red bike when I was a child, and it even had a padded seat cover. I rode it to school and around my neighborhood almost every day, which helped me become more independent.
Do you think bikes are popular in your country?
スコア: 40.0提案: 回答要直接并使用相关词汇(bikes 而不是 bags)。先给出观点,然后用一到两条具体原因支持,并用连接词(because, so, however)。避免模糊或不连贯的表达,如“the back is not much convenient”应改为更清晰的原因(例如道路条件、交通习惯或便利性)。保持句子简洁,时态通常用现在时。
例: No, I don't think bicycles are very popular nowadays because many people prefer driving cars for convenience. Also, busy roads and limited bike lanes make cycling less safe, so fewer people choose bikes for daily travel.
